Janeology

Karen Harrington

Publisher: Kunati Incorporated

Pub. Date: April, 2008

ISBN-13: 9781601640208

246pp

Tom Nelson’s wife Jane suddenly snaps one day and drowns their two year old twins.  One survives and the other doesn’t.  Jane is found not guilty by reason of insanity and is sentenced to an institution for life.  A year later, the prosecution decides to try to convict Tom for negligence.  Tom’s mother hires a lawyer who brings in a psychic who delves into Jane’s past to come up with a defense for Tom.  What they begin to uncover is shocking, and may just reveal why a mother would kill her own children.
 
We have all heard the phrase “the sins of the father” and it is just this concept that the author, Karen Harrington, explores.  Just who is to blame for this horrible crime? How can a mother commit such a horrible act?  These are all questions we ask every time we see something like this on the news.  Janeology is original in that the story consists of flashbacks told through the psychic who goes back in time into Jane’s past to see what may have led her to do such a thing.  In fact, my favorite part of the story was about Jane’s ancestors.  This was exactly what made Janeology unique. It causes us to think about these questions and that is what makes for a good book.  The subject matter may be hard to read, especially for mothers, but Janeology is a thoughtful and challenging book and that is why I would highly recommend it.
